Creditworthy Conference

A new edition this year. I thought it might be nice to get some credit for taking the initiative and furthering our own education. So I signed up to be a Professional Development Provider with the State of Illinois. This means I can and will provide continuing professional development units (CPDU) to those who wish to earn them. Email me for more details.
This was both and easy decision and a difficult one. I think we all deserve credit for coming to EdCamp. I think we learn more than we would in most sponsored professional developments, if simply because we are choosing what we want to learn.
On the other hand I think an unconference can very easily devolve into a CPDU factory. (Which would make it on par with the majority of sponsored professional developments.)
I don’t want that to happen. We as teachers need to take charge of our profession. We need to be saying, “This is what good high quality education looks like.” Then we need to take what we learned back to our districts and use it to improve our classrooms and our schools.
That is happening now. That is what we are doing when we take our valuable time and use it to further our own professional education. I don’t want to dilute that effort by giving people the option of coming to EdCamp to earn cheap CPDU’s. I do want to acknowledge that we work hard to improve our own craft. I would also like to acknowledge that educators can and should be the leaders in our own professional development. Thus the option of earning CPDU's.

We’re At It Again


It has taken a bit longer than planned, but EdCampChicago is ready to host another unconference.

Last year it was great to have such a strong showing from so many Wisconsin educators and we hope some return this year, but many people also suggested EdCampChicago should be closer to Chicago.

While I was busy eyeing a nice junior college down town Leyden School District stepped up and practically begged to be the next host. Well they offered anyway, and what an offer it was.

First they offered as many classrooms as we wanted, we are hoping to more than double the number of participants to 250 educators. Then they offered Smart Boards in almost every classroom. What about WiFi? we asked. Of course, they responded.

Then we started asking for more.
Will you invite school board members? Yes.
We would love to see students get involved do you think they might want to do things like video tape, and provide concierge services? Yes, and we will do one better, we’ll ask our Cuisine Club about running a coffee and sandwich shop.

Hmmm, I wonder if they have an auto shop at this high school?

I am looking forward to February 2012, EdCampChicago 2012 is shaping up to be an awesome event.



EdCamp Chicago is being held at East Leyden High School (3400 Rose St, Franklin Park, IL 60131-2184) on Saturday, February 11, 2012 from 9:00 A.M.-3:00 P.M.  Come and join us for a day of great professional development!
